Boğaziçi University's promotional days tender sparks controversy: Contract awarded to company of former AKP candidate nominee

Boğaziçi University's 2 million lira promotional days tender has sparked reactions due to the company's former owner being a former candidate nominee from the AKP.

Boğaziçi University's 2 million lira tender for the organization of its 2024 university promotional days has drawn attention. The tender in question was awarded to a company founded by an individual who was previously a candidate nominee from the AKP.

According to information obtained, the firm that undertook the organization of the promotional events is FSM İletişim Hizmetleri.

The company's founder, Fatih Erol, was a candidate nominee for the Gaziosmanpaşa Mayoralty from the AKP in 2014. Erol transferred ownership of the company to other individuals with the surname "Erol" approximately three years ago.
